空间地理技术蓬勃兴起 --------数据库管理系统迎难而进 ------------ 组织和存储地理特性---- -------- R-树状索引---------------- 数据刀片(DataBlade)----------------应用发展永无止境 --------
Java开发与前端开发极其类似,Java的通用构建工具maven对应前端npm;依赖管理pom.xml对应package.json;当然也有脚手架Sping Initializr等等。Web接口操作数据库大致经历如下步骤: graph TB Web--http-->Controller Controller-->Service Service-->DAO Reposito
转载 2023-07-26 23:31:35
133阅读
C/C++ 对 MySQL API 的使用简介 文章目录C/C++ 对 MySQL API 的使用简介1. C/C++ 使用 API介绍2. C/C++ 环境配置和操作示例代码2.1 Mysql环境配置2.2 mysql代码示例 希望快速上手的码友可以直接翻到目录的 2.2. C/C++ 环境配置和操作示例代码MySQL 数据库是一个 C/S 结构(客服端 / 服务器),当我们安装好 MYSQL
转载 2023-07-05 10:04:46
148阅读
分库分表---理论当一张表的数据达到几千万时,查询一次所花的时间会变长。业界公认MySQL单表容量在 1千万 以下是最佳状态,因为这时它的BTREE索引树高在3~5之间。数据切分可以分为:垂直切分和水平切分。 一、垂直切分 垂直切分又可以分为: 垂直分库和垂直分表。1、垂直分库概念 就是根据业务耦合性,将关联度低的不同表存储在不同的数据库。做法与大系统拆分为多个小系统类似,按业务分类进行独立划
转载 20天前
417阅读
# MySQL数据库API介绍及代码示例 MySQL是一种开源的关系型数据库管理系统,广泛应用于Web应用开发中。MySQL提供了多种编程语言的API,用于连接和操作数据库。本文将介绍MySQL数据库API的一般用法,并提供一些常见的代码示例。 ## MySQL数据库API的常见用法 ### 连接数据库 在使用MySQL数据库API之前,我们需要先连接到目标数据库。下面是一个Python代
原创 2023-09-18 18:49:17
72阅读
1.2 PostgreSQL数据库与其他数据库的对比1.2.1PostgreSQL与MySQL数据库的对比可能有人会问,既然已经有一个人气很高的开源数据库MySQL了,为什么还要使用PostgreSQL?这主要是因为在一些应用场景中,使用MySQL有以下几个缺点:功能不够强大:MySQL的多表连接查询方式只支持“Nest Loop”,不支持“hash join”和“sort merge join”
java 备份数据库1 首先我们要先写一个备份类 BackupDb.java 代码如下: import java.io.BufferedWriter; import java.io.FileWriter; import java.io.IOException; import java.sql.SQLException; import java.tex
转载 2023-06-22 15:40:41
118阅读
MySQL API 方式 BLOB 类型,读写 二进制文件(图像) 代码复制在VS2012中,控制台方式,顺利运行。 说明也写的用心。感谢! 在此篇佳作基础上,我补充了一点点新学来的内容。首先BLOB的记录写和读操作。要点体会:1) 按照字节为单位,字符为类型,组织 长长的“query”,通过API与MYSQL交
转载 2023-07-05 16:03:21
153阅读
摘要:应广大API爱好者要求,写了一篇利用自己数据库标点的文章……---------------------------------------------------------一、先按照前两篇文章那样,做好静态文件。请看两篇文章:1、制作自定义标注和自定义信息窗口 http://www.cnblogs.com/milkmap/archive/2011/08/04/2127663.ht
原创 2011-08-16 17:06:00
661阅读
 国土调查数据库管理系统及共享服务平台 平台已开发完成,可提供源码或项目合作,有意向请留言· 部分截图建设内容最终实现的系统功能要求:第三次国土调查数据库软件,具备外业采集、数据数据库检查、数据更新(维护)等功能。外业采集子系统用于第三次国土调查外业调查采集,满足外业变化图斑调绘,专项信息采集,以及要素属性更改、图斑涂鸦等需求。系统应包含底图导入、图层管理、图斑调绘、
MySql接口API相关函数MySql接口API相关函数1、部分API函数总览1.1、部分API函数表1.2、部分MySql结构体说明1.3、API函数使用步骤2、mysql_init()——MYSQL对象初始化2.1、函数原型及参数说明2.2、简单使用3、mysql_real_connect()——数据库引擎建立连接3.1、函数原型及参数说明3.2、简单使用4、mysql_query()——查询
连接数据库的步骤MySql数据库是一个典型的C/S结构,包括客户端和服务器。当部署好了MySql服务器,想通过程序访问服务端的数据,在编写程序的时候,可以通过官方提供的C语言API来实现。     在程序中连接MySql服务器主要分为以下几个步骤:初始化连接环境连接MySql服务器。需要提供如下连接数据: MySql服务器IP地址MySql服务器监听端口。默认是
转载 2023-07-05 12:59:04
75阅读
mysql数据库现在已经成为市场占有率最高的数据库,在开发过程中,很多情况下我们都需要操作mysql,所以对于python操作mysql的了解是必不可少的。Python标准数据库接口为Python DB-API, Python DB-API为开发人员提供了数据库应用 编程接口。地址:https://wiki.python.org/moin/DatabaseInterfaces,你可以查看pyt
转载 2023-10-11 15:56:40
114阅读
Python连接Mysql数据库操作、以Excel文件导入导出一、Pycharm连接Mysql数据库操作 - 增删改查操作1、写入(增加)数据在pycharm中先安装 pymysql第三方在Mysql数据库软件中支持的增删查改操作在pycharmy语法中也是支持的例如:增删改查tb_dept数据库部门表的数据import pymysql no = input('部门编号:') name = i
转载 2023-07-05 14:33:55
130阅读
JDBCJDBC(Java Database Connectivity)是数据库连接,是一套执行SQL语句的JavaAPI。应用程序可以通过这套API连接到关系型数据库,并使用SQL语句来完成对数据库数据的查询、更新、新增和删除的操作。DML,DDL,DCLDML 数据操纵语言,比如SELECT、UPDATE、INSERT、DELETE。 主要用来对数据库数据进行一些操作。DDL 数据库定义语
转载 2024-09-29 07:18:13
84阅读
《高性能的数据库》 第一讲:范式设计        首先,俺说,数据库重在设计,然后才是开发。按照第三范式开发,会让你提升到一个新的境界!        名词解释:         第一范式
 关于managedQuery和query的区别,我们都知道在Android系统中,SQLite数据库的相关操作方式被封装为内容提供Content Provider,可以帮助那些不会SQL语言的开发者快速实现Android平台上的数据库操作,但是平时我们在查询时一般返回的是Cursor对象,从本质上来看这两个API是不同的类提供的。比如 ContentResolver.query(),以
转载 精选 2012-07-03 11:02:46
629阅读
零、开发环境操作系统:Ubuntu 16.04 及以上 或 Windows 8 及以上Python版本:3.5及以上开发工具:PyCharm数据库:MySQL一、环境配置创建虚拟环境通过命令行进入虚拟环境,输入命令在虚拟环境中安装MySQL Client: pip install mysqlclient 二、简单讲解在这篇文章中我会利用 mysqlcli...
原创 2021-07-08 13:51:41
289阅读
1.初始化一个链接结构。2.创建一个链接。3.执行查询。4.关闭链接。MYSQL* conn;首先,声明一个conn指针指向一个MYSQL结构体,这个结构体就是一个数据库连接句柄。conn = mysql_init(NULL);函数mysql_init将返回一个链接句柄。if (conn == NULL) { printf("Error %u: %s\n", mysq
在上一篇博客——《第一行代码—Android》基础知识点总结chapter6——中,已经对“文件存储”、“SharedPreferenced存储”这两种数据持久化方式做了简要说明,在这片文章中我们再来简单看看SQLite数据库存储,下面进入实战时间。Android系统中内置了SQLite数据库。那么什么是SQLite数据库呢?SQLite数据库就是一款轻量级的关系型数据库,他的运算速度非常快,而且
转载 2024-10-10 17:19:49
38阅读
  • 1
  • 2
  • 3
  • 4
  • 5